I have both Baten Kaitos and BK: Origins. VO is painfully bad, so turn it off ASAP. Battle system is interesting -- it reminds of a modified game of poker against no opponent.. BK:O's battle system makes it too easy, though -- they just simplified the original one.
FF:CC -- fun with four people; requires GBAs to do so. Single-player is far too difficult because it's nigh impossible to keep that crystal around while you fight.
Fireblade: never even heard of it.
F-Zero GX -- It's F-Zero all over again. Nothing new, but if you like F-Zero, you'll like GX.
SFA -- Not bad, but not great. Definitely worth playing, but definitely not a long-time favorite.
